Here is some info I found on the web: The Technics RS-640US is a stereo cassette deck with Dolby B noise reduction, it was first sold by Technics in 1976 with a manufacturer suggested retail price of USD $349 and discontinued a year later. The main features of the Technics RS-640US are: 2 heads, mechanical 3 digit tape counter, tape type selection and capable of handling normal and chrome tapes, belt driven single-capstan transport. Typical of this deck is the 70's top loading layout with the cassette compartiment located on the left side of the deck. Tape eject is operated mechanically and the cassette needs to be placed with the side to be played facing forward in the cassette well. Level meters used on the RS-640US are analog needle VU reading meters. Mechanical transport controls for reliable RS-640US transport function selection. The Dolby-B system reduces tape hiss on tapes recorded on the RS-640US by as much as 10 dB at the highest frequencies.
